// WEBHOOK_MAX_RETRIES governs delivery attempts for the Ostrel dispatcher.
// Retries use exponential backoff with jitter, capped at six attempts;
// after that the event parks in the dead-letter queue for manual replay.
// Do not raise this without checking downstream idempotency — partners
// like Bramleigh dedupe on event id only. If you change this constant,
// record the validating build token below.

pipeline stamp: htk9_ce63042d9

## Further reading

So you want to go deeper on Drizzlebot? Good call. The scheduler is mostly a cron wrapper with soil-moisture overrides, but the override logic has some sharp edges — especially around greenhouse zones that share a valve. Skim the valve-contention notes before touching anything there, and check the sensor calibration guide too. All of that, plus the architecture sketch, is gathered on the page below.

wiki page, bajog-tahop: https://confluence.qorvelsys.internal/browse/pages/pages/pages

## Deployment

This release of Thistlegraph ships the batched resolver that eliminates the N+1 pattern on nested author lookups. The fix is gated behind a flag so it can be disabled without a redeploy if batching introduces ordering issues. Please verify during review that the batch window, maximum keys per batch, and cache toggle match what was load-tested on the Bramwick staging cluster. The deployed values are reproduced here for reference.

service settings:
[silwyn]
host = silwyn.crelvogrid.internal
user = silwyn_svc
database = silwyn_prod

Q: Does Quillgate catch typo-squatted packages before release?

A: Yes. Quillgate scans every dependency manifest at build time and flags names within edit distance two of popular packages. Flagged builds are blocked, not warned. Overrides require a signed allowlist entry reviewed by the security rotation. Scan results are retained for ninety days. For the current allowlist and override procedure, see the internal page below.

runbook for tajop-bafog: https://confluence.qorvelsys.internal/display/browse/display/display/9d3e